Highlights

This groundbreaking course helps attendees understand why digital currencies matter and how best to advise clients.

A $100 investment in Bitcoins in 2010 would be worth over $75 million today. What is the reason for this unfathomable explosion in value? Daily, there is an average of over 300,000 unique Bitcoin transactions processed. Companies of all sizes now accept Bitcoins for payments. As auditors, tax preparers, and advisors to businesses and investors from all walks of life, it is our professional duty to understand the changes orchestrated by Bitcoins and their digital currency cousins.
